The Carriere Self-Ligating Bracket is one of the fastest growing self-ligating brackets on the
market today. It is specifically designed to meet your goal of low friction and low force by
providing a "freedom of fit" in the bracket and archwire interface:
In the body of the bracket, the mesial and distal
edges of the slot have been carefully rounded for
free sliding.
The bracket archwire interface has a passive four-wall
design that, with low super-elastic archwires, provides
a free but controlled, synergistic action.
The "passive" orthodontic treatment philosophy can be "activated" when there is interest in using
more force by using larger rectangular archwires.
A simple locking mechanism located in the bracket
face, which can be easily opened with an explorer
and closed with the touch of finger -- offering quick,
easy archwire changes.
• A familiar rhomboid shape that allows you to keep
your preferred treatment techniques.
• Available in .018 and .022 McLaughlin, Bennett and
Trevisi* and .018 and .022 Roth* prescriptions,
